Sparky v4.5.2-x64-Mate on Lenovo Thinkpad T450s
Clock display is 10 hours behind Time Zone (Pacific/Auckland - GMT+12)
Searched Menu for appropriate area to check I had set correct data on installation but could not find anything appropriate. Note: MATE on Linux Mint has setting Time and Date which shows this information. Is there an equivalent in Sparky?
Tried to set correct time through Clock by right clicking on icon and choosing Preferences/Time Settings
Set time to correct figure and then clicked on Set System Time.
Entered password and clicked on authenticated
Clock shows correct time for Session but is incorrect on a reboot by the 10 hours mentioned.

QuoteIn a terminal - as root or via sudo
Code: [Select]
dpkg-reconfigure tzdata

Running sudo dpkg-reconfigure tzdata
revealed that the timezone was set to Europe ::) Resetting it to Pacific/Auckand solved the problem and I am now a very happy geriatric ;D
